    BRIC, MAVINS and PIIGS Back in 2003 the acronym BRIC was used by Goldman Sachs when talking about the economies of Brazil, Russia, India and China combined. The report speculated that by 2050 these four economies would be wealthier than most of the current major economic powers. In 2010, the Business Insider used the acronym…
